
Internship - Software Developer
EsriPosted May 22, 2025
Sharjah, United Arab Emirates
Internship
Job Description
This internship offers hands-on experience in GIS software development, where interns work on real projects, contribute to improving ArcGIS products, and learn from experienced team members in a full-time, paid environment.
Responsibilities
- •Contribute to real projects and collaborate with team members
- •Research methods to improve software or solve new problems
- •Design, test, and document new functionality in ArcGIS products
- •Develop use cases demonstrating the value of spatial analysis
- •Create educational content explaining how to use ArcGIS
Requirements
- •Be a current undergraduate or graduate student who is graduating this semester or will be returning to school in the fall.
- •Have basic knowledge of GIS and remote sensing.
- •Possess excellent test engineering and problem-solving skills.
- •Have strong development skills using Java, C++, or Python.
- •Have the desire and ability to learn new skills and contribute to producing quality commercial software.
Benefits
- •Full-time, paid internship with competitive salary
- •Up to twelve-week program with flexible start dates
- •Free software training courses
More jobs at Esri

3D Software Engineer II Scene Layers
Esri
Jan 24